Abstract:
Conceptual world image is considered as a variable structure, which consists of a constant set of interconnected domains, one of which is time. Correlation changeability of the world image components is stipulated by the subject's way of world perception implemented in a certain type of discourse (here either scientific or philosophic anthropocentric is meant). Correspondingly, time domain correlation with other domains in the conceptual world image is subject to variations depending on the type of the world perception, within which the subject forms his/her notion of time and verbalises it in discourse.
